About Caroline Springs 3023

The size of Caroline Springs is approximately 8.4 square kilometres. There are 50 parks, covering nearly 21.4% of the total area. The population of Caroline Springs in 2016 was 24205 people. By 2021 the population was 24488 showing a population growth of 1.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Caroline Springs is 40-49 years. Households in Caroline Springs are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Caroline Springs work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 75.10% of the homes in Caroline Springs were owner-occupied compared with 74.30% in 2016.

Caroline Springs has 8,969 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Caroline Springs have seen a 13.86%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 14.09% increase. As at 30 June 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Caroline Springs is $826,131 while the median value for Units is $541,361.
  • Houses have a median rent of $550 while Units have a median rent of $520.
